The Tacoma Planning Commission will hold a public hearing for the 2008 Critical Areas Preservation Ordinance update. The hearing will start at 5 p.m. on Weds., April 16, in the City Council Chambers on the First Floor of the Tacoma Municipal Building, 747 Market St. The purpose of the public hearing is to allow all interested persons an opportunity to comment on proposed revisions to the Tacoma Municipal Code Chapter 13.11 Critical Areas Preservation Ordinance (CAPO) and TMC Chapter 13.05 Land Use Permit Procedures. The proposed 2008 revisions to CAPO include standards and regulations for fish and wildlife habitat conservation areas (FWHCAs), including marine buffer requirements and management areas for priority species.
